FBI issues nationwide warning on ricin toxin
By Andrew Buncombe in Washington
11 January 2003
The FBI yesterday issued a nationwide alert about ricin days after the arrest in London of seven men allegedly connected with an Algerian extremist group and the discovery of a small amount of the poison in their flat.
The Bureau contacted 17,000 law-enforcement officials, and provided advice and information on how to handle ricin and warning how the deadly toxin might be used in a terror attack.
"Use of ricin toxin as a weapon would be most effective in an assassination by injection or as a food contaminant," the bulletin said. "Ricin could be used in a terrorist operation to contaminate closed ventilation systems such as heaters or air conditioners, drinking water, lakes, rivers and food supplies."
It said that ricin can be made in liquid, crystal or dry powder form and that in low doses, it has a laxative rather than lethal effect. But it warned that if inhaled or ingested, serious symptoms such as fever, cough, shortness of breath, chest tightness and low blood pressure are expected within eight hours. Death can come between 36 and 72 hours.
There have been a small number of cases in the US that involved the use or near-use of ricin, the bulletin said. But officials said they no information to suggest that a ricin attack was planned against any US target. The seven men held in London are still being questioned.
£ Britain's biggest chain of garden centres has stopped selling castor plant seeds from which ricin can be extracted. Plants and seeds are off the shelves at all 124 Wyevale Garden Centres. The firm said it was taking them out of circulation "in light of recent events".
